TOWSON, Md. --- Four Moravian College baseball players have been honored by the Landmark Conference with sophomore outfielder Matt Hanson earning a spot on the 2013 Landmark All-Conference First Team, junior pitcher Robert Solano and sophomore third baseman Ryan Luke named to the All-Conference Second Team and freshman first baseman Charles Savite honored as the Rookie of the Year.
WASHINGTON, D.C. --- The third seeded Moravian College baseball team captured its second Landmark Conference Championship in four seasons and an automatic berth to the 2013 NCAA Division III National Championship Tournament with an 8-5 victory over fourth seed The University of Scranton in the 2013 Landmark Conference Tournament hosted by The Catholic University of America Monday.
